## Tuning

GiftPost batches donation receipts before handing them to the send queue. Batch size and retry backoff interact: raising one without the other causes duplicate receipts under provider timeouts, which finance at Larkmont Trust will notice immediately. Verify staging numbers against last quarter's peak before each release cut. The constants below are the only values you should adjust.

limits module of hadug-hahop:
PRIORITIES = {
    "zorwyn": 182,
    "ralael": 588,
    "aldax": 782,
}

Runbook: shrinkray CLI. The shrinkray tool batch-resizes images for the Cobblenest storefront. Run it from the media box, never your laptop — it hammers the disk. Flags: --width, --quality, --bucket. Output lands in the processed bucket automatically. Uploads require the storage access key, which the CLI reads from the env file's next line.

vault entry, yahif-yajep: COURIER_KEY29=b802bdf8034096b65a51c6ba5abe2

Subject: Key rotation — Gatewren canary gating

Hi,

As part of this quarter's review, we rotated the credential that the Gatewren service uses to evaluate canary deploy gating rules. Scopes are unchanged: read on rollout metrics, write on gate verdicts. The old key expires Friday. For your audit record, the new key follows.

API key for yahig-tadup: kto7_ubizbYm

Fan-out backpressure for the Quillet notifier: when the queue depth crosses the soft limit, the dispatcher sheds low-priority pushes and batches the rest at 500ms intervals. Reviewer should confirm the shed counter is exported and that retries respect the jitter window. Once merged, the release artifact gets re-signed by the pipeline, which expects the deploy key shown below.

deploy key for bawep-yawif: bky6_GQhaSt